al-lŭbentĭa (
al-lŭbentĭa (adl-), ae, f. lubet, a liking or inclination to, a fondness for: jam adlubentia proclivis est sermonis et joci, et scitum est cavillum, i. e. voluntas loquendi et jocandi, App. M. 1, p. 105, 12 Elm.
